tech-supportA few days ago on the Niche Blogger Members Forum, someone mentioned that CyberHub was have a sale on their articles.  One dollar per article for a limited time!  Of course this was highly interesting to those of us who are working on unique articles for niche blogs.

I headed on over to the website to check it out.  First of all, there is a cheesy intro that you have the option of skipping.  Skip it.  Trust me.  But once you get into the site, you can get information about the sale that’s going on.

“We have now implemented our one month promo together with the launching of CyberHub Online: Version 2.0. Starting from February 16-March 15,2009, our rates will be down from $0.006/word to $0.004/word (This is a rare promo we only offer once a year).

To avail of the discounted promo, Input DP101 in the coupon code. For rush orders, you can ignore the coupon code and pay with our normal pricing ($0.006/word). Each order is entitled to a 100% work back guarantee, so you don’t have to worry about substandard articles.”

This was great news! But since I had never ordered from them before, I was unsure about what kind of quality I would get for $1.00 per article.

I decided to give it a shot.  I ordered 6 articles.  Three from one niche and three for another. I got to enter in which keywords I wanted in each article, as well as a bit of other information.  I got the first three in my email box last night.

The articles were actually pretty good.  I was pleasantly surprised.  I only had a to make a couple of spelling corrections to them and the SEO was outstanding.  If you’re looking for some articles for a niche blog, this is a great place to get them cheap!  The sale only lasts until March 15th, though, so do your ordering soon.

    I can’t say I had good luck with Cyberhub. About 11 days ago, I decided to test Cyberhub and see what kind of quantity and turn around time frame they offered. I submitted an order for just 10 article of 400 words each with the understanding that I would get a receipt with the estimated completion time on it. I got the receipt but no estimated project completion time. After about 8 days I sent them an email asking for a project completion date and they in turn sent me an automated email stating they would get back to me in about 24 to 48 hours. I have not received any notice from them as of yet and its been more than 48 hours. Also I had used their tracking service but it just says Project in queue. Does anyone know if this is the normal way they do business because maybe I’m not waiting long enough. I’m use to getting work done through Elance and getting it back in about 10 days.
